# @turf/distance

## distance

Calculates the distance between two [coordinates][1] in degrees, radians, miles, or kilometers.
This uses the [Haversine formula][2] to account for global curvature.

### Parameters

*   `from` **[Coord][1]** origin coordinate
*   `to` **[Coord][1]** destination coordinate
*   `options` **[Object][3]** Optional parameters (optional, default `{}`)

    *   `options.units` **Units** Supports all valid Turf [Units][4]. (optional, default `'kilometers'`)

### Examples

```javascript
var from = turf.point([-75.343, 39.984]);
var to = turf.point([-75.534, 39.123]);
var options = {units: 'miles'};

var distance = turf.distance(from, to, options);

//addToMap
var addToMap = [from, to];
from.properties.distance = distance;
to.properties.distance = distance;
```

Returns **[number][5]** distance between the two coordinates

This module is part of the [Turfjs project](https://turfjs.org/), an open source module collection dedicated to geographic algorithms. It is maintained in the [Turfjs/turf](https://github.com/Turfjs/turf) repository, where you can create PRs and issues.

### Installation

Install this single module individually:

```sh
$ npm install @turf/distance
```

Or install the all-encompassing @turf/turf module that includes all modules as functions:

```sh
$ npm install @turf/turf
```
